So we're asked to classify the following substances as non -electrolites, weak electrolytes, or strong electrolytes.
00:08
So, well, i'll just do it with the text right fast.
00:14
So if it's a molecular species, it's not going to dissociate, so it's going to be a non -electrolite, which i'll just write an n.
00:25
And then if it's ionic and soluble, it's going to be a strong electrolyte because it will form lots and lots of ions that can conduct electricity.
00:36
For that, i'll put an s.
00:38
And then if it's ionic and insoluble, that means it only slightly dissociates.
00:43
And that makes it a weak electrolyte.
00:49
So those are the rules that we're using.
